Clash Royale Rune Giant Overview
The Rune Giant is an Epic card that zeroes in on enemy Towers and defensive buildings. At tournament standards, it boasts 2803 Hitpoints and a Medium movement speed, dealing 120 damage to buildings—outpacing an Ice Golem but falling short of a Giant's might.
What truly distinguishes the Rune Giant is its Enchant effect. Upon deployment, it enchants two nearby troops, boosting their damage every third hit. This unique ability to amplify your troops' power makes the Rune Giant a formidable force in strategic card combinations.
With a cost of just four elixirs, the Rune Giant is easy to cycle without draining your elixir reserves. Pair it with fast-firing troops like the Dart Goblin to trigger the Enchant effect multiple times, or use it with slower attackers to maximize its impact.

While the Rune Giant isn't robust enough to serve as a primary win condition like the Golem, it excels as a support troop that can distract enemies and absorb tower hits during your push.

Goblin Giant Cannon Cart
While the Goblin Giant Sparky combo remains a strong beatdown option, the Goblin Giant Cannon Cart deck offers a fresh take when incorporating the Rune Giant.
Card Name | Elixir Cost |
---|---|
Evo Goblin Giant | 6 |
Evo Bats | 2 |
Rage | 2 |
Arrows | 3 |
Rune Giant | 4 |
Lumberjack | 4 |
Cannon Cart | 5 |
Elixir Collector | 6 |
This deck combines solid defense with powerful counter-pushes, capable of handling various attack styles. The Rune Giant buffs the Cannon Cart and Goblin Giant, including the Spear Goblins on its back, amplifying their damage output. The Elixir Collector is key to maintaining elixir advantage, while the Lumberjack and Rage provide additional boosts. However, the deck's lack of air defense, aside from Evo Bats, makes it vulnerable to Lava Hound decks.
This deck uses the Royal Chef Tower Troop.
Battle Ram 3M
Though the Three Musketeers have fallen out of the meta, the Rune Giant breathes new life into this classic deck.
Card Name | Elixir Cost |
---|---|
Evo Zap | 2 |
Evo Battle Ram | 4 |
Bandit | 3 |
Royal Ghost | 3 |
Hunter | 4 |
Rune Giant | 4 |
Elixir Collector | 6 |
Three Musketeers | 9 |
This deck functions similarly to a Pekka Bridge Spam, using Bandit, Royal Ghost, and Evo Battle Ram to apply early pressure. The Elixir Collector helps build an elixir lead, crucial for the Double Elixir phase. Avoid deploying the Three Musketeers during the Single Elixir stage unless you can capitalize on your opponent's mistakes.
For defense, the Rune Giant and Hunter combo is lethal, with the Rune Giant tanking and the Hunter dealing enhanced damage thanks to the Enchant buff. Evo Zap supports your Battle Ram's push on the enemy tower.
This deck uses the Tower Princess Tower Troop.
Hog EQ Firecracker
Currently, the Hog EQ Firecracker is the top Hog Rider deck in the meta, and the Rune Giant has significantly boosted its performance.
Card Name | Elixir Cost |
---|---|
Evo Skeletons | 1 |
Evo Firecracker | 3 |
Ice Spirit | 1 |
The Log | 2 |
Earthquake | 3 |
Cannon | 3 |
Rune Giant | 4 |
Hog Rider | 4 |
This deck plays similarly to its traditional counterpart, with the Rune Giant replacing the Valkyrie or Mighty Miner. The synergy between the Rune Giant and Firecracker is game-changing, allowing the Firecracker to deal massive damage with every third hit. The Earthquake spell aids in late-game tower damage, while Evo Skeletons handle defensive duties despite recent nerfs.
This deck uses the Tower Princess Tower Troop.
